Well I don't know what some of these guys are on about because I tried it today and thought it was fan-bloody-tastic if you're looking for the original Firearms feel. Sure it's missing some elements but mostly that's content based (where's my bloody durandal!?! ;)) - but I can't criticise gameplay overly.

Couple of points though:

1) Hard to tell when enemies are capturing points - yes the flag starts changing (and I think it's a bit glitchy) but you need an audio alert.

2) Some animations are buggy, I think sprinting when out of stamina causes the animation to glitch.

3) Maps are bland, generally need detailing.

Your changelog looks good though, I did notice the G36 had especially bad recoil when scoped, so look forward to the patch.

Oh also, the bipod key isn't assigned by default which causes problems.

New Scoring Values

We have decided to change scoring to make promotions less frequent, while still awarding fair points. Objectives now give you 3 points, frags give you 2 points, and assists give you 1 point. Thus, promotions have been moved to every 10 points to accommodate for these changes.

Push Reinforcement Drains

Due to rushing teams often getting out gunned by the more defensive players, we wanted to reward those rushers by draining reinforcements from the opposing team based on how many forward control points they own. For each control point they grab from the middle point onward, the reinforcements are drained by 3 reinforcements every 60 seconds. So on maps like Crossfire, you will drain 6 reinforcements every 60 seconds if you own the middle and fourth control point. If you are playing on Sand and you capture the third control point, you will drain the enemies reinforcements by 3 every 60 seconds.

Rewarding Aiming

We have increased the head hitbox multiplier to 2.5 from 2 and the chest hitbox multiplier to 1.3 from 1.0. This will reward players who keep their crosshair on the enemies' head, as opposed to those who just spray as many bullets as they can at the enemy. We have also increased the accuracy bonus of semi auto weapons and burst weapons, so that you can get headshots at distances.
